Output ddb99eccb9d04c862899e75c6648da0d180b1037a8660f7fcd0d5f6145220314:1

value
43722573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 220c4a09f88e8288024e7be079f9da5ecae9e31f OP_EQUAL
address
MB1BvpdYcsHQEQrCco9pXf1Yim7o444xuj
transaction
ddb99eccb9d04c862899e75c6648da0d180b1037a8660f7fcd0d5f6145220314
spent
true